Chapter 5: The Research Methods of Biopsychology
Methods of Visualizing and Stimulating the Living Human Brain
- Contrast x rays
o Use this to figure out blockages of blood vessels
o Simple diagnostic tools
- Xray computed tomography
o Computer looks at different sections of the brain
o All computer automated
o Compose a picture of the brain based on blood flow

- MRI
o Really good alternative to other things
o Really high resolution and can choose which sections of the brain you wanna see
o Blood is being sent to the tissue → can see different densities of the brain
o Downside: can only take pictures of the brain, can only determine structural things of the brain,
NOT the functions of the brain
o Good: for detecting tumors
- PET
o Tells you function but not structure
o Heat map of the most active parts of the brain
▪ Red: being used the most, blue: not as used
o Injection of a substance radioactive FEG
▪ Minimally harmless but it is invasive
o Whichever part of your brain is being used, increased blood flow to the region
o Downside: invasive
- fMRI
o gives you function and structure of the brain
o measures the BOLD signal

- MEG
o More on the scalp
- TMS
o NOT a measure of neural activity
o Artificially make different parts of the brain work and not work
Recording Human Psychophysiological Activity
- EEG
o Noninvasive; Electrodes just touch your head
o Neurons create and electrical field when its working so the electrodes will measure the
brainwaves
o Wave form assessments
o Used a lot in sleep studies
o Bad: stops at the skull
